{- | ==== placeholder syntax:

       * index based

            { Int }

       * key based

            { 'String' | 'ByteString' | 'Text' }

    other placeholders may be implemented with

    "Text.Regex.Do.Pcre.Ascii.Replace" or "Text.Regex.Do.Pcre.Utf8.Replace"       -}

module Text.Regex.Do.Format
    (Format(..),
    ReplaceOne(..),
    Formatable) where

import Prelude as P
import Text.Regex.Do.Type.Do
import Text.Regex.Do.Split as S (replace)
import Text.Regex.Do.Convert
import Data.ByteString as B
import Data.Text as T


type Formatable a = (Format a [a], Format a [(a,a)])

{- | ==== implemented a:

    * 'String'
    * 'ByteString'
    * 'Text'      -}

class Format a arg where
   format::a    -- ^ text to format e.g. "today is {0}"
        -> arg  -- ^ replacement: [a] or [(a,a)]
        -> a    -- ^ formatted text


instance ReplaceOne Int a =>
    Format a [a] where
   format = foldr_idx foldFn_idx
{- ^ === index based
     >>> format "на первое {0}, на второе {0}" ["перловка"]

     "на первое перловка, на второе перловка"

     >>> format "Polly {0} a {1}" ["got","cracker"]

     "Polly got a cracker"
-}

foldFn_idx::ReplaceOne k v =>
    v -> (k, v) -> v
foldFn_idx v0 (i0, body1) = replaceOne body1 i0 v0



instance ReplaceOne a a =>
    Format a [(a, a)] where
   format = P.foldr foldFn_map
{- ^=== key based
     key may be {any a}

     >>> format "овчинка {a} не {b}" [("a","выделки"),("b","стоит")]

     "овчинка выделки не стоит"
-}
